In this masked era, you notice those whose smile reaches their eyes, as it does with the staff at Costa Navarino. The service is also attentive due to the high staff-to-guest ratio.

Costa Navarino was the brainchild of the late Captain Vassilis Constantakopoulos, who grew up in Messinia and made a fortune in shipping. It was conceived, in large part, to ensure the people of his home region have employment to allow them to remain in the area, and to preserve the local culture and landscape.
